Output 20686cf5c957b43463735e711d74ba9ac2f76952d0b63679dbc4b7b668d9d617:1

value
25884232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a23e3c1c8a83f75fa99fbc6c1e694ead00940f2e OP_EQUAL
address
MNh2Ff4vuFAr9CrE2PyfdXCRAfiQRFFqs7
transaction
20686cf5c957b43463735e711d74ba9ac2f76952d0b63679dbc4b7b668d9d617
spent
true